Exeter beat Gloucester 40-39 in a thriller at Sandy Park as both sides qualified for next season's Heineken Cup.
Christian Wade took his tally to 13 Premiership tries but could not prevent Wasps from going down 21-20 to Sale at the Salford City Stadium.
Defending champions Harlequins turned on the style to secure third place in the Aviva Premiership with a 22-19 win over Northampton.
Saracens confirmed top spot in the final Aviva Premiership table with a 23-14 win over Bath at Allianz Park.
Leicester Tigers ran in five tries as they beat London Irish 32-20 to secure a home Aviva Premiership semi-final.
